Major-General Bryan Grimes: Extracts of Letters to His Wife
The last man to be appointed by Robert E. Lee as a major general in the Confederate Army of Virginia during the American Civil War, Bryan Grimes also led the final attack before the surrender at Appomattox. He was a plantation owner before and after the war.

During the Civil War, Grimes fought in nearly every major engagement in the eastern theater of the war. This collection of letters to his wife are valuable for his comments on the current state of the war from the southern side.
